Egyptian Valencia oranges — late-season juice-and-table orange for the Uzbek bridge.

Why this page exists

Valencia extends the Egyptian orange window past Navel into the shoulder months (Feb–Aug) and doubles as juice-grade feedstock for P6 processors. It also covers the Uzbek demand window just before the domestic apricot and stone-fruit harvest starts.

Required sections

  1. Cultivar spec — Valencia standard, Valencia late; Brix 11–13; acidity giving juice utility; slight seediness; thick rind for long shipping.
  2. Packaging — 15 kg export carton; bulk 18 kg for processing; industrial totes for juice-grade.
  3. Season — Feb → Aug (Egypt); peak Mar–Jun.
  4. Routing — Sea Aktau for table grade · Bulk sea for juice · Mersin TIR for express retail.
  5. Reefer setpoint +4 to +6 °C.
  6. Juice-grade spec — Brix 10.5+ minimum, acidity 0.8–1.3%, pasteurise- grade suitable for Uzbek juice-plant intake.
  7. Per-persona cards — P2 FCL volume retail, P3 wholesale roll, P6 processing grade.

Required FAQs

  • Q: Can we buy juice-grade Valencia in bulk for an Uzbek juice plant? A: Yes. Juice-grade Valencia in 18 kg bulk cartons or totes is a standard P6 programme line; Brix 10.5+, acidity 0.8–1.3%, residue cert included.
  • Q: What's the difference between Valencia and Navel for retail? A: Navel is the winter premium eating orange (Nov–May, Brix 11–14, seedless, easier peel). Valencia is the spring-summer table orange (Feb–Aug), longer shelf life, slightly seeded, better for juicing.
  • Q: Can Valencia FCL share a container with Medjool retail packs? A: Yes for CIF Tashkent / Aktau sea routes — mixed-cultivar reefer at +4 to +6 °C tolerates the combined load.
